This verse links faith in Allah and the Last Day to serenity.
مَنۡ ءَامَنَ بِٱللَّهِ وَٱلۡيَوۡمِ ٱلۡأٓخِرِ وَعَمِلَ صَٰلِحٗا فَلَهُمۡ أَجۡرُهُمۡ عِندَ رَبِّهِمۡ وَلَا خَوۡفٌ عَلَيۡهِمۡ وَلَا هُمۡ يَحۡزَنُونَ
Whoever believes in Allah and the Last Day and does righteous deeds will have their reward with their Lord; no fear will come upon them, nor will they grieve.
Quran, Al-Baqara 2:62
This verse combines faith in Allah and the Last Day with performing righteous deeds. It promises those who unite these two aspects a reward from their Lord, as well as freedom from fear and grief. In our daily lives, this promise invites us to cultivate sincere trust in Allah and to take concrete actions of kindness. Serenity comes from this dual approach: believing and acting.
